Brandywine Realty Trust shares edged up 0.67% to close at $3.00, remaining within a tight trading range defined by support at $2.85 and resistance at $3.15. The stock is attempting to build upward momentum amid a cautious broader real estate sector, with investors watching for a decisive move above the key resistance level.

Tuesday’s session saw Brandywine Realty Trust (BDN) rise by 0.67% to $3.00, a modest gain that reflects tentative buying interest near the middle of its recent consolidation band. The price action comes as the broader Real Estate Select Sector SPDR Fund (XLRE) showed mixed performance, with office-focused REITs continuing to face headwinds from remote-work trends and elevated interest rates. Despite these sector pressures, BDN has held above its established support floor of $2.85 for several weeks, suggesting that sellers have not been able to drive the stock lower. Volume during the session was in line with recent averages, indicating that the move higher lacked aggressive accumulation but also did not generate significant selling pressure. The stock’s ability to close above the psychologically important $3.00 round number may provide a short-term boost to sentiment. The price action appears to be largely driven by sector-wide positioning ahead of upcoming economic data, rather than company-specific catalysts. Brandywine’s portfolio, concentrated in the mid-Atlantic region, remains under scrutiny as office leasing demand remains subdued, though any improvement in leasing activity could act as a tailwind.

From a technical perspective, BDN is navigating a defined range between support at $2.85 and resistance at $3.15, with the stock currently residing near the midpoint at $3.00. The price has been consolidating within this band for several weeks, forming a series of higher lows near $2.85, which may indicate that buying interest is gradually increasing. A sustained move above the $3.15 resistance level could signal the start of a more significant uptrend, potentially targeting the next overhead zone near $3.35–$3.40. Technical indicators are currently providing mixed signals.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) appears to be in the neutral zone, likely in the mid-40s to low-50s range, suggesting that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old. The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) line appears to be hovering near its signal line, implying a lack of clear directional momentum. Price action is trading around short-term moving averages, with no strong trend evident. The consolidation pattern itself is often considered a prelude to a breakout, but the direction remains uncertain until the stock decisively exits the range.

Looking ahead, Brandywine Realty Trust faces a few potential scenarios depending on how it resolves its current trading range. If the stock can generate sufficient buying momentum to break above resistance at $3.15, it could challenge the $3.35–$3.40 area in the coming weeks. Conversely, failure to hold above $3.00 may lead to a retest of support at $2.85, and a breakdown below that level could open the door to further downside toward $2.70 or lower. Several factors could influence the stock’s direction. A decline in long-term interest rates would likely benefit all REITs, including BDN, by lowering borrowing costs and improving valuations. Additionally, positive updates on office leasing activity or cost-saving measures could provide company-specific catalysts. On the macroeconomic front, upcoming employment and inflation reports may sway investor sentiment toward rate-sensitive sectors. Traders should watch for a close above $3.15 on above-average volume as a bullish confirmation, while a close below $2.85 would signal renewed weakness.
